Staff Band in Iowa City
The Chicago Staff Band (Bandmaster William Himes) traveled to Iowa City, Iowa on Saturday, 24 April 2010 for a weekend which included a joint concert with the Eastern Iowa Brass Band (Conductor Casey Thomas).

National Capital Band Annual Dinner 2010
Traditionally, the National Capital Band ends each season with a dinner for the members and guests. In 2010, the dinner was held two weeks early because the last event of the season is a ministry trip to Scranton, Pennsylvania at the end of May. Sunday at Ferntree Gully
The Melbourne Staff Band (Bandmaster Ken Waterworth) visited the Ferntree Gully Corps, in the outer eastern suburbs of Melbourne, on Sunday 18 April 2010.
